What was the berlin conference of 1884

History
2 answers:
Vsevolod [243]3 years ago
8 0

Answer: The Berlin Conference of 1884–85, also known as the Congo Conference regulated European colonization and trade in Africa during the New Imperialism period and coincided with Germany's sudden emergence as an imperial power.
